Klaviyo pricing structure
Klaviyo charges based on active profiles (contacts). The free plan covers 250 profiles. Paid plans start at $20/mo for 251–500 profiles and scale up significantly - 10,000 profiles is $150/mo, 50,000 profiles is $700/mo. SMS is billed separately per message. If you're on a large paid plan, the savings from downgrading can be substantial.
Klaviyo vs Mailchimp vs ConvertKit for e-commerce
Klaviyo is the dominant choice for Shopify and WooCommerce stores due to deep native integrations and powerful segmentation. Mailchimp has broader SMB appeal and a more generous free tier (500 contacts, 1,000 emails/month). ConvertKit/Kit is better for creator businesses. If you're canceling Klaviyo for cost, Mailchimp or Omnisend are the natural e-commerce alternatives.
Frequently asked questions
- Will my Klaviyo flows stop running if I downgrade to free?
- On the free plan, flows continue to run but are limited to the 500 email/month send limit across all sends. Once you hit the limit, emails queue until the next month. Downgrade only if your flow volume is low.
- Does Klaviyo offer refunds?
- Klaviyo does not offer prorated refunds for the current billing period. Contact billing@klaviyo.com within 30 days for billing errors.
- Can I export my Klaviyo email templates?
- Klaviyo doesn't have a direct template export feature. You can manually copy the HTML from each template in Settings → Templates → Edit → HTML view. Alternatively, document your template structure with screenshots before canceling.
